Break of Structure (BOS) signals trend continuationβit occurs when price breaks the previous swing high (uptrend) or swing low (downtrend).
Change of Character (CHOCH) is your early warning signal that a trend may be reversingβit's the first meaningful break against the established trend.
A CHOCH alone doesn't confirm a trend reversal. You need a BOS in the new direction after the CHOCH to confirm the trend has actually changed.
Market Structure Shift (MSS) is essentially the same as CHOCHβmost traders use these terms interchangeably.

Break of structure (BOS) is a signal that indicates trend continuation. In an uptrend, BOS occurs when price breaks above the previous swing high. In a downtrend, it occurs when price breaks below the previous swing low. It confirms that the existing trend is still intact and continuing.
Change of character (CHOCH) is the first meaningful break against an established trend. It serves as an early warning signal that the trend may be reversing. For example, in an uptrend, CHOCH occurs when price breaks below the previous swing low for the first time.
BOS signals trend continuation (price breaking with the trend), while CHOCH signals a potential trend change (price breaking against the trend). Think of BOS as confirmation that your trend is healthy, and CHOCH as a warning that something may be shifting.
Yes, for most traders market structure shift (MSS) and change of character (CHOCH) mean the same thing. Both terms describe the first significant break against an established trend. The terminology can vary between trading communities, but the concept is identical.
No, a change of character alone does not guarantee a trend reversal. CHOCH is only an early warning. To confirm an actual trend change, you need to see a break of structure (BOS) in the new direction after the CHOCH. Without that confirmation, the original trend may resume.
First, identify the swing highs and lows of the current trend. In an uptrend, you need higher highs and higher lows. BOS occurs when price makes a new high. CHOCH occurs when price breaks below the most recent swing low. Real charts can be messy, so focus on the significant swing points rather than minor fluctuations.
Yes, BOS and CHOCH concepts work on any timeframeβfrom 1-minute charts to monthly charts. However, higher timeframes typically provide more reliable signals with less noise. Many traders use higher timeframes to identify the overall trend and lower timeframes for entry timing.
